is a in Conejos County, , . Its surface elevation is 10,984 feet. The name "Acascosa" probably comes from Spanish agua ascosa, meaning "stagnant water". It is located just under 20 miles from Capulin, Colorado. is situated 2½ miles northeast of Roaring Gulch.
